move_note silently performed a same-project move (creating a nested folder) and reported success when an agent intended a cross-workspace/cross-project move. This closes three gaps: - Gap 1: broaden cross-boundary detection to reject a leading path segment that is a known project name AND the cloud workspace shape '<workspace>/projects/<x>/...', while leaving legitimate same-project nested moves (e.g. 'projects/2025/file.md') untouched. - Gap 2: validate outcome vs. intent after move_entity returns; if the resulting file_path diverges from the requested destination, report failure instead of '✅ moved successfully'. This is the robust backstop. - Gap 3: run the cross-boundary guard AFTER destination_folder is resolved into destination_path, so the destination_folder path no longer bypasses detection. No destination-project/workspace parameter is added — real cross-project moves remain a separate, larger feature. This change only makes the tool honest. Narrow workspace-shape detection to actual boundary paths
For a normal same-project move into a nested folder named projects, such as archive/projects/moved.md or team/projects/2026/moved.md, this new check rejects the request before move_entity runs even though the path is a valid relative path within the project. The tool otherwise allows arbitrary nested folders and the added integration test only preserves top-level projects/...; matching any interior projects segment makes legitimate organization layouts unusable unless users rename their folder.

Detection 2 in _detect_cross_project_move_attempt scanned every interior path segment for a literal "projects" and rejected the move, producing false positives for legitimate same-project nested folders such as notes/projects/my-project/note.md or team/2026/projects/alpha/note.md. Replace the interior-scan loop with a single targeted check that fires only for the actual cloud workspace shape <workspace>/projects/<x>/... — i.e. when path_parts[1] == "projects" and len(path_parts) >= 3. Detection 1 (leading segment equals a known project name) is unchanged. Addresses Codex P2 and claude-review medium false-positive findings. Report the destination project, not workspace
For workspace-shaped destinations like team-space/projects/alpha/moved.md, this branch formats the error with target_project=path_parts[0], so the guidance says the target project is team-space and even suggests write_note(..., project="team-space"). In the documented <workspace>/projects/<x>/... shape, <x> is the project being targeted, so users following the error message will try to write into the workspace name instead of the actual project (alpha).
